Transaction 577751da035ce7c982bd591e31ff990a884f874829d4d7047f3075a001c41cf3
1 Input
2 Outputs
- 577751da035ce7c982bd591e31ff990a884f874829d4d7047f3075a001c41cf3:0
- 577751da035ce7c982bd591e31ff990a884f874829d4d7047f3075a001c41cf3:1
value 32552
address 164nbBzy2FcoJCQAGqXzqmcuh6zaEZjYzo
value 625900
address 3HM7SR76EBzayu2pXWoBVFk4RFqRM8jcrM